While many are waiting to see what the next batch of material from Eight Foot Fluorescent Tubes’ lead singer Trey Anastasio will sound like, Big Red takes another looks backwards with the release of a new live album. Original Boardwalk Style features the best tracks from the Undectect’s electric 2006 New Year’s Eve run at the House of Blues in Atlantic City.
The live album drops on June 10, and is currently available for pre-order as a cd and as a double-gatefold, audiophile grade 180-gram LP Vinyl pressing at Drygoods.
